Burials in Conne River cemetery. We estimate this is only half of the burial plots there. These are the only records we could find in the St. Ignatius Church in St. Alban's (Formerly Ship Cove). From our examination, these are records of burials starting at the location of a large Junipher Tree and going east. If you visit the greveyard, you can see there is still half the burial area stretching from the Junipher to the west.
